Device Modeling Report




COMPONENTS:
DIODE/ SCHOOTTKY RECTIFIER / STANDARD
PART NUMBER: HSC278
MANUFACTURER: RENESAS




              Bee Technologies Inc.


 All Rights Reserved Copyright (C) Bee Technologies Inc. 2004
PSpice model
                                  Model description
 parameter
     IS        Saturation Current
     N         Emission Coefficient
     RS        Series Resistance
    IKF        High-injection Knee Current
    CJO        Zero-bias Junction Capacitance
     M         Junction Grading Coefficient
     VJ        Junction Potential
    ISR        Recombination Current Saturation Value
     BV        Reverse Breakdown Voltage(a positive value)
    IBV        Reverse Breakdown Current(a positive value)
     TT        Transit Time
    EG         Energy-band Gap

Comparison Graph


Circuit Simulation Result




Simulation Result

                              Vfwd(V)            Vfwd(V)
          Ifwd(A)                                                     %Error
                            Measurement         Simulation
            1.00E-06               0.075               0.074                  -0.93
            1.00E-05               0.130               0.132                   1.46
              0.0001               0.196               0.194                  -1.12
              0.0002               0.215               0.214                  -0.56
              0.0005               0.245               0.244                  -0.45
               0.001               0.270               0.272                   0.81
               0.002               0.312               0.312                  -0.16
               0.005               0.385               0.390                   1.30
                0.01               0.530               0.525                  -0.87

Comparison Graph


Circuit Simulation Result




Simulation Result

                               Cj(pF)            Cj(pF)
           Vrev(V)                                                   %Error
                            Measurement        Simulation
                     0.1           18.600            18.200                   -2.15
                     0.2           17.800            17.700                   -0.56
                     0.5           15.780            15.800                    0.13
                       1           13.980            13.800                   -1.29
                       2           11.700            11.600                   -0.85
                       5            8.950             9.000                    0.56
                      10            7.300             7.200                   -1.37
